Jacalin Ding Uplifting design strategists for the new era

Jacalin Ding is a Design Leader and Business Strategist who has spent 18 years connecting design work to measurable business outcomes.

She has advised CEOs and founders through raising millions in funding through seed, series A and B, launched AI initiatives that doubled revenue, and built multiple six-figure businesses across New York, Vancouver, Tokyo, Singapore, and Sydney.

Since 2018, Jacalin has taught over 10,000 designers to become strategic business partners. Her students come from Google, Meta, DoorDash, LinkedIn, Visa, and Atlassian - many earning promotions to Lead Strategic Designer and Product Strategist roles.
